Abstract: A handover method, including sending, by a source base station to a source core network device in a process of handing user equipment (UE) over from the source base station to a target base station, a handover required message. The message comprises identification information of a target core network device, and the identification information of the target core network device instructs the source core network device to perform a core network relocation process with the target core network device. The source base station is connected to the source core network device, and the target base station is connected to both the source core network device and the target core network device.

Abstract: This application discloses a network access method, a network device, and a terminal. The method includes: obtaining, by a network device, indication information, where the indication information is used to indicate whether the terminal supports air communication; and when the indication information indicates that the terminal supports the air communication, determining, by the network device, that the terminal is allowed to access a network in which the network device is located. In this application, a quantity of unmanned aerial vehicle terminals that access the network can be limited, reducing interference caused by the unmanned aerial vehicle terminals to another terminal in the same network as the unmanned aerial vehicle terminals, and improving communication quality of the another terminal.
